In mid-September 2023, the reporter of the cover news "Silk Road Decade" reporting team went to Indonesia and experienced the familiar Chinese speed in an exotic country.

40 minutes is the time of a lesson, 1/3 of the time of a movie, and the time it takes to cross 142.3 kilometers from Jakarta to Bandung by the Yavan high-speed train. But for these 40 minutes, China's high-speed rail people spent eight years digging tunnels, erecting high bridges, pulling up power grids, and laying tracks, reducing the 4-hour journey to 40 minutes.

The meaning of all this needs to be felt personally. We departed from Jakarta at 3pm and took a car to Bandung. After 4 hours of bumps, at 7 p.m., the sunset has set, and the moment we step off the car with a tired body and mind, we understand the expectations and pride of the Indonesian people for the Yawan high-speed railway.

Gunawan is a native of Bandung who participated as a translator in the construction of the Yawan high-speed railway. He translated countless professional terms and told us the most sincere thoughts of the Indonesian people, "With the Yawan high-speed railway, the work and life of people along the line will change dramatically. ”

Indonesia is the fourth most populous country in the world with a population of 275 million. Its capital, Jakarta, is the largest city in Southeast Asia and one of the most densely populated and traffic-congested regions in the world. Traffic congestion in Jakarta and even on the Indonesian island of Java has long plagued Indonesians. Now, the Yawan high-speed railway whistling across the island of Java has given the optimal solution to this problem.

During the interview, we took the Yawan high-speed train several times, and saw Indonesian girls in festive costumes taking photos with the Yawan high-speed railway in the station, as well as Indonesian people challenging "standing coins" and "releasing water cups" in the moving train. In communicating with them, we found that many Indonesians can speak some simple Chinese.
